On July 29, the Securities and Exchange Commission once again updated its planned schedule for adopting rules and taking other actions to implement the corporate governance and disclosure provisions of the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act. As reported in the April 15, 2011, edition of Corporate and Financial Weekly Digest, the SEC had previously announced its revised planned rule making schedule to implement provisions of the Dodd-Frank Act.
